My Buying Guides on Headboard For Queen Bed
Why I Think a Headboard Matters
When I started looking for a headboard for my queen bed, I realized it was more than just a decorative piece. A good headboard can make the bedroom feel complete, give me extra comfort while sitting up in bed, and protect the wall behind the bed from wear. It also helps define the style of my room, whether I want something modern, classic, cozy, or luxurious.
How I Decide on the Right Size
The first thing I check is size. Since I have a queen bed, I make sure the headboard is made specifically for a queen frame or is adjustable enough to fit properly. I always measure the width of my bed and the available wall space before buying. I also pay attention to the height, because I want the headboard to look balanced without overwhelming the room.
The Material I Prefer
Material makes a big difference in both comfort and appearance. When I want a soft and cozy feel, I go for upholstered headboards in fabric or velvet. If I want something more durable and easy to clean, I consider wood or metal. I like wood for a warm, timeless look, while metal works well when I want a more minimal or industrial style. For me, the best material depends on how I use the bed and the overall look I want.
Style That Matches My Bedroom
I always choose a headboard that fits my bedroom decor. If my room has a modern design, I look for clean lines and simple shapes. If I want a more elegant feel, I choose tufted or curved designs. For a rustic bedroom, I lean toward wood with natural finishes. I’ve learned that the headboard should blend with the bed frame, bedding, and wall color so the whole room feels coordinated.
Comfort Is Important to Me
Since I often sit up in bed to read or watch TV, comfort is a big factor. I like padded headboards because they give me support and feel better against my back and head. If I choose a hard material like wood or metal, I make sure it still looks good and fits my style, but I know it may not be as comfortable for long sitting periods.
Installation and Compatibility
I always check how the headboard attaches to the bed frame. Some headboards mount directly to the frame, while others need wall mounting. Before I buy, I make sure the hardware is included and that it will work with my queen bed frame. I also look at how easy it is to install, because I prefer something that doesn’t require too much effort or extra tools.
Durability and Maintenance
I want my headboard to last, so I pay attention to build quality. Solid wood, strong metal frames, and well-made upholstery usually give me better long-term value. I also think about maintenance. Fabric headboards may need occasional vacuuming or spot cleaning, while wood and metal are usually easier to wipe down. I choose based on how much upkeep I’m willing to do.
Budget and Value
When I shop for a headboard, I set a budget first. I’ve found that the most expensive option is not always the best one for me. I look for a balance between price, comfort, style, and durability. Sometimes a simple design gives me better value than a fancy one with features I won’t use. I always compare a few options before making my final decision.
